"log"
"os"
- "bitbucket.org/anacrolix/go.torrent"
"bitbucket.org/anacrolix/go.torrent/tracker"
_ "bitbucket.org/anacrolix/go.torrent/tracker/udp"
"bitbucket.org/anacrolix/go.torrent/util"
"os"
"strings"
- "bitbucket.org/anacrolix/go.torrent/util"
-
"github.com/anacrolix/libtorgo/metainfo"
"bitbucket.org/anacrolix/go.torrent"
+ "bitbucket.org/anacrolix/go.torrent/util"
)
var (
package main
import (
- "bitbucket.org/anacrolix/go.torrent/util"
- "bitbucket.org/anacrolix/go.torrent/util/dirwatch"
"flag"
"log"
"net"
"syscall"
"time"
+ "bitbucket.org/anacrolix/go.torrent/util"
+ "bitbucket.org/anacrolix/go.torrent/util/dirwatch"
+
"bazil.org/fuse"
fusefs "bazil.org/fuse/fs"
"bitbucket.org/anacrolix/go.torrent"
package torrent
import (
- pp "bitbucket.org/anacrolix/go.torrent/peer_protocol"
"container/list"
+
+ pp "bitbucket.org/anacrolix/go.torrent/peer_protocol"
)
type DownloadStrategy interface {
package torrentfs
import (
+ "log"
+ "os"
+ "strings"
+ "sync"
+
"bazil.org/fuse"
fusefs "bazil.org/fuse/fs"
"bitbucket.org/anacrolix/go.torrent"
"github.com/anacrolix/libtorgo/metainfo"
- "log"
- "os"
- "sync"
)
const (
package torrent
import (
- "bitbucket.org/anacrolix/go.torrent/mmap_span"
- "bitbucket.org/anacrolix/go.torrent/peer_protocol"
"crypto"
"errors"
- "github.com/anacrolix/libtorgo/metainfo"
- "launchpad.net/gommap"
"math/rand"
"os"
"path/filepath"
"time"
+
+ "bitbucket.org/anacrolix/go.torrent/mmap_span"
+ "bitbucket.org/anacrolix/go.torrent/peer_protocol"
+ "github.com/anacrolix/libtorgo/metainfo"
+ "launchpad.net/gommap"
)
const (
package torrent
import (
- "bitbucket.org/anacrolix/go.torrent/mmap_span"
- pp "bitbucket.org/anacrolix/go.torrent/peer_protocol"
- "bitbucket.org/anacrolix/go.torrent/tracker"
"container/list"
"fmt"
- "github.com/anacrolix/libtorgo/bencode"
- "github.com/anacrolix/libtorgo/metainfo"
"io"
"log"
"net"
"sync"
+
+ "bitbucket.org/anacrolix/go.torrent/util"
+
+ "bitbucket.org/anacrolix/go.torrent/mmap_span"
+ pp "bitbucket.org/anacrolix/go.torrent/peer_protocol"
+ "bitbucket.org/anacrolix/go.torrent/tracker"
+ "github.com/anacrolix/libtorgo/bencode"
+ "github.com/anacrolix/libtorgo/metainfo"
)
func (t *torrent) PieceNumPendingBytes(index pp.Integer) (count pp.Integer) {